I have a north mountain leafy suit for early and late season. one in obsession and one in break up country for the early season. No issues have had them both about 5 years now. Once the weather warms up I just wear a pair of OD green doctors scrubs under mine. I am retired from the Army and they sell them on base at Fort Campbell. I have some scrubs in the BDU woodland pattern also.

I've carried an 870 spring gobbler hunting for more years than I care to mention but, I'm thinking a single shot Stevens 301 for next season. I'm older and more wore out and a lighter gun is in my future. I'm thinking 12ga but hear lot's of good things about their 20ga. I have a set of identical twin 870's in 12 & 20 and honestly the 20ga can hold it's own.  I've got several months to figure it out.

I think the Stevens shoot pretty good, but I am opting for a semi in 20 gauge. Just my personal preference but I like a quicker follow up shot is needed. So far I have not needed one with a shotgun. But I know once I switch to a single shot I will need one.
